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

Projects in Awesome Lists tagged with state-machine

A curated list of projects in awesome lists tagged with state-machine .

https://github.com/ssube/cautious-journey

label manager and state machine for Github and Gitlab

github-labels github-workflow gitlab-label gitlab-workflow labels state-machine workflow

Last synced: 05 Nov 2024

https://github.com/tromagon/Gonity

A set of tools (including ECS, Dependency Injections, Events, ...) to quickly start new projects in Unity

delegate entity-component-system event-driven gonity injection injector reflection sequence state-machine unity unity3d viewmodel-pattern

Last synced: 10 Nov 2024

https://github.com/taffarel55/conways-game-of-life

Implementação do jogo da vida (conways game of life) em java script e em eletrônica digital (implementação física)

conways-game-of-life jogo-da-vida state-machine

Last synced: 09 Jan 2025

https://github.com/ba-st/cannon

State Machine implementation

mit-license pharo smalltalk state-machine

Last synced: 16 Nov 2024

https://github.com/briebug/smartish

Smartish is a small utility library that makes creating "smartish" components in Angular a breeze

angular component-architecture components ngrx state state-machine state-management state-pattern typescript

Last synced: 24 Nov 2024

https://github.com/catseye/beta-juliet

MIRROR of https://codeberg.org/catseye/beta-Juliet : A minimal event-oriented language

esolang event-driven-behavior event-driven-programming experimental-language state-machine

Last synced: 15 Nov 2024

https://github.com/r3labs/statemachine

A simple state machine implementation

callback golang state-machine transition

Last synced: 15 Nov 2024

https://github.com/xinpianchang/xpc-advanced

An advanced utilities for more complicated cases, use @newstudios/common as a dependency

dispatcher disposable kvo retry-strategies state-machine task task-queue

Last synced: 07 Dec 2024

https://github.com/royalicing/mini_modules

A subscript of JavaScript modules in Elixir

elixir esmodules liveview parser-combinators phoenix state-machine

Last synced: 18 Nov 2024

https://github.com/collardeau/staterize

A state machine for derived state designed for React

reactjs state-machine state-management

Last synced: 31 Dec 2024

https://github.com/jbarbadillo/pyfsm

A simple finite state machine for event driven applications

fsm state-machine

Last synced: 10 Jan 2025

https://github.com/swiftech/swstate

A really easy to use but powerful State Machine implementation based on Java 8 with zero dependencies.

java state state-machine

Last synced: 18 Nov 2024

https://github.com/hollodotme/state-machine-generator

PHP code generator for OOP state machines

code-generator oop php state-machine

Last synced: 21 Nov 2024

https://github.com/oldrev/esp-idf-smf

A port of the Zephyr RTOS SMF(State Machine Framework) to the ESP-IDF framework.

esp-idf esp32 espressif idf smf state-machine zephyr zephyr-rtos

Last synced: 21 Nov 2024

https://github.com/stevana/supervised-state-machines

An experimental implementation of Erlang/OTP's gen_server and supervisor behaviours that doesn't use lightweight threads and message passing.

haskell state-machine supervisor

Last synced: 15 Dec 2024

https://github.com/seaqqull/lazy-bot

Implementation of AI in Unity.

state-machine unity unity-ai unity3d

Last synced: 08 Dec 2024

https://github.com/julienetie/soucouyant-old

Functional Persistent State for Humans

memorization state state-machine state-management stateful

Last synced: 16 Dec 2024

https://github.com/cliffhall/dungeonjoe

A casual, touch-focused strategy game, written with PureMVC, Adobe ActionScript, Flex, Air. Read more: http://bit.ly/dungeon-joe

actionscript actionscript3 adobe air as3 flex game puremvc state-machine

Last synced: 09 Dec 2024

https://github.com/factomproject/ptnet-eventstore

Smart contract protocol constructed using pflow Petri-nets

blockchain petri-net protocol state-machine

Last synced: 24 Dec 2024

https://github.com/tsepanx/state-bot

A telegram bot uses transitions python module

python state-machine telegram-bot

Last synced: 20 Nov 2024

https://github.com/iron-bound-designs/ironbound-state

State Machine Library for PHP 7.2+

php state-machine

Last synced: 09 Jan 2025

https://github.com/guilhermestracini/poc-dotnet-cqrs

🔬 Proof of Concept of CQRS pattern in .NET using RabbitMQ, ReBus, State Machine, MediatR and Docker

cqrs dotnet dotnet-core machine mediator mediatr patterns patterns-design poc rabbitmq rebus state state-machine

Last synced: 01 Dec 2024

https://github.com/mk590901/door_simulation_on_toit

The repository contains the source files for the automatic door modeling application in the toit language for the ESP32 controller.

simulation state state-machine toit toit-language

Last synced: 18 Dec 2024

https://github.com/erikjuhani/umbrellajs

UmrellaJS is a collection of libraries for various tasks and needs.

dice ecs event-stream monorepo prng random roman state-machine typescript vector yarn yarn3

Last synced: 08 Jan 2025

https://github.com/mk590901/custom_widget_painter

The repository contains the implementation on flutter the stateless widget for visualization ECG.

algorithms-and-data-structures bloc dart flutter state state-machine

Last synced: 18 Dec 2024

https://github.com/walkerdustin/simple-python-statemachine

This code is an example for how to implement a simple State Machine using just standard Python (no library)

blueprint finite-state-machine fsm python simple skeleton state-machine

Last synced: 30 Dec 2024

https://github.com/lexus2k/sm_engine

State machine engine for small projects

arduino-library esp32 state-machine statemachine

Last synced: 21 Dec 2024

https://github.com/3imed-jaberi/game-of-life

Implementation of Conway's Game of Life in JavaScript (ES6+).

es6 eventemitter2 mvp-architecture state-machine

Last synced: 18 Dec 2024

https://github.com/giovannibedetti/statemachinetoolkit

A First Person Toolkit that lets you create your State Machine using the Unity Animator, without writing a line of code!

first-person-game state-machine toolkit unity

Last synced: 01 Jan 2025

https://github.com/customcommander/xmachina

A small DSL that compiles to XState.

dsl finite-state-machine state-machine tagged-template xstate

Last synced: 23 Dec 2024

https://github.com/applegreengrape/serverless-ts-log

This is my learning project to get hands-on sam + step functions + typescripts

aws-sam lambda learning-by-doing serverless state-machine step-functions typescript

Last synced: 16 Nov 2024

https://github.com/leizongmin/holyhi

state management library for React that very easy to use

preact react redux state state-machine

Last synced: 19 Dec 2024

https://github.com/bios-marcel/tictactoecli

A little tictactoe game for the commandline, written in go.

cli state-machine tictactoe

Last synced: 13 Nov 2024

https://github.com/mcquerol/reaction-game-psoc5-erikaos

Reaction game for PSoC5 with ERIKA OS. Explores embedded design and RTOS.

buttons c erika-os osek psoc5 rtos seven-segment-display state-machine uart

Last synced: 04 Jan 2025

https://github.com/thadeu/nanomachine

🔐 nanomachine is a state machine for tiny JS

aasm-js fsm fsm-js nanomachine state-machine state-machine-js

Last synced: 19 Dec 2024

https://github.com/peternaydenov/fsm

Finite State Machine Implementation

fsm state-machine

Last synced: 11 Nov 2024

https://github.com/stonecypher/fsl_traffic_light_ukrainian

The FSL traffic light example, translated to Ukrainian by @miles91

fsl fsl-machine jssm jssm-machine machine state-machine

Last synced: 13 Dec 2024

https://github.com/damiancipolat/planta_iot_arduino

Repositorio creado para la materia, paradigmas de robotica de UAI sede centro 2020

arduino iot nodemcu plants sensors state-machine

Last synced: 28 Dec 2024

https://github.com/drorspei/sismicpp

A C++ library for running statecharts

cpp cpp14 state-machine statechart

Last synced: 30 Dec 2024

https://github.com/bbc/sfn-sim

AWS Step Functions simulator for unit testing state machines

aws ignorearchive state-machine step-functions testing

Last synced: 06 Nov 2024

https://github.com/drittich/state-machine

A simple convention-based finite state machine that lets you pass event data through to your transition actions.

state-machine state-machine-cs state-machines statemachine statemachine-library statemachines

Last synced: 17 Dec 2024

https://github.com/mcquerol/24ghz-imp165-speed-measurement

24GHz radar sensor (IMP165) project for speed measurement. Includes signal processing and embedded dev.

adc dac dsp embedded-system freesoc2 imp165 pcb soldering state-machine

Last synced: 09 Nov 2024

https://github.com/pbentes/source-engine-movement

WIP Source Engine movement in Godot 4.x

godot locomotion source-engine state-machine

Last synced: 21 Dec 2024

https://github.com/tophercantrell/fsm

Declarative Finite State Machines

propeller-spin raspberry-pi state-machine tictactoe

Last synced: 17 Nov 2024

https://github.com/brucou/react-app-simple

Demos for https://github.com/brucou/react-state-driven

demo functional-reactive-programming reactjs state-machine statecharts

Last synced: 18 Dec 2024

https://github.com/mcquerol/electronic-clock-psoc5-erikaos

Electronic clock using PSoC5 and ERIKA OS. Features RTOS, UART, and display interfacing.

c clock erika-os osek psoc5 rtelight rtos state-machine tft-display uart watchdog-timer

Last synced: 04 Jan 2025

https://github.com/sulmar/4developers-state-machine

Przykłady z prezentacji "Maszyna stanów w praktyce" na konferencji 4Developers

csharp dotnet-core state-machine

Last synced: 02 Jan 2025

https://github.com/jaleelb/dfa-analyzer

A C++ library to create, load, and analyze Deterministic Finite Automata (DFA) with up to 10 states and lowercase letter alphabets. Offers file loading, state modification, and string acceptance checks.

automata-theory cplusplus-library deterministic-finite-automata dfa dfa-construction state-machine

Last synced: 10 Jan 2025

https://github.com/andydevs/jump

An experiment in writing interpreted languages in C++

programming-language state-machine

Last synced: 02 Jan 2025

https://github.com/cemoktra/rusty_state

A simple state machine for rust

rust state-machine

Last synced: 19 Dec 2024

https://github.com/tlapnet/stamus

:arrows_counterclockwise: State machine

php state state-machine state-management tlapnet

Last synced: 15 Nov 2024

https://github.com/owen2345/transitions_listener

Listen all state transitions and make actions before and after the transition is saved

rails rails-model state-machine state-transitions static-transitions

Last synced: 20 Dec 2024

https://github.com/xgfone/go-fsm

A simple Non-Hierarchical Finite State Machine based on the event.

finite-state-machine finitestatemachine fsm state-machine statemachine

Last synced: 04 Dec 2024

https://github.com/alinz/fsm.go

a finite state machine in Golang

finite-state-machine fsm golang state-machine timeout

Last synced: 24 Nov 2024

https://github.com/frodsan/chappie

Minimal Finite State Machine

minimalist python state-machine

Last synced: 22 Dec 2024

https://github.com/bdelacretaz/openwhisk-statebox

Exprimenting with restartable state machines on OpenWhisk

javascript nodejs openwhisk state-machine statebox

Last synced: 19 Dec 2024

https://github.com/1602/pure-ish

Side-effects manager for backend Javascript apps.

functional-programming side-effects state-machine state-management

Last synced: 28 Nov 2024

https://github.com/sintef-9012/jasm

Java State Machine

java state-machine

Last synced: 08 Jan 2025

https://github.com/jamesmoriarty/mini-aasm

A State Machine library intended to be compatible with lightweight implementations of the Ruby language using 100LOC and only standard libraries.

domain-specific-language dragonruby mruby ruby state-machine tinycode

Last synced: 02 Dec 2024

https://github.com/hydrocarbons/carbon-fsm

Carbon FSM is a async enabled lightweight but powerful finite state machine for javascript/nodejs

2019 adf async carbon finite fsm hydrocarbons javascript lightweight machine node-fsm nodejs react state state-machine state-machine-dsl

Last synced: 16 Nov 2024

https://github.com/Nurgak/IoT-Weather-Station

Internet-of-Things temperature and humidity sensor based on the ESP8266-01 and DHT11 sensor, using MQTT

dht11 esp8266 gpl internet-of-things iot mqtt state-machine weather-station

Last synced: 23 Oct 2024

https://github.com/mcquerol/electronic-gas-pedal-psoc5-erikaos

Electronic gas pedal system with PSoC5 and ERIKA OS. Focuses on embedded C and UART.

c erika-os joystick osek psoc5 rtelight rtos state-machine uart

Last synced: 04 Jan 2025

https://github.com/guillempuche/actors-and-state-machine

Actor models and state machines in a React web thanks to XState v5 package

actor-framework actor-model state-machine xstate

Last synced: 15 Dec 2024

https://github.com/dljsjr/stately

A simple cyclic synchronous finite state machine framework

embedded embedded-rust finite-state-machine rust state-machine

Last synced: 24 Nov 2024

https://github.com/rcarubbi/carubbi.statemachine

Generic State Machine Aspect-oriented-programming based Implementation

aop csharp generic-state-machine state-machine

Last synced: 13 Nov 2024

https://github.com/ged/pushdown

A pushdown automaton toolkit for Ruby.

automaton pushdown-automaton state-machine

Last synced: 18 Dec 2024

https://github.com/wmfs/tymly-cli-rest-client

CLI tool to launch Tymly State Machines over REST

cli state-machine tymly

Last synced: 04 Jan 2025

https://github.com/azhovan/stater

An Advanced | Fast PHP 7 State Machine Manager

dfa fdm fsm php php72 state-machine state-machines statemachine stater transition

Last synced: 18 Nov 2024

https://github.com/ccnokes/simplestatemachine

Javascript state machine that keeps things simple

javascript state-machine

Last synced: 17 Nov 2024

https://github.com/mk590901/switch-tc-rust

The repository contains app demonstrates the use of threaded code for state machine on Rust

hsm rust state-machine threaded-code

Last synced: 06 Jan 2025

https://github.com/endail/pioasm-action

GitHub Action to assemble PIO files

pico pio pioasm raspberry-pi-pico rp2040 state-machine

Last synced: 18 Dec 2024

https://github.com/mk590901/switch-tc-dart

The repository contains app demonstrates the use of threaded code for state machine on Dart

dart hsm state-machine threaded-code

Last synced: 18 Dec 2024

https://github.com/mk590901/task_management_bloc

The repository contains an application implemented asynchronous task management using the BLoC pattern.

async-task bloc dart flutter state-machine state-management

Last synced: 18 Dec 2024

https://github.com/mk590901/switch-tc-kotlin

The repository demonstrates the use of threaded code for state machine in a Kotlin application.

hsm kotlin kotlin-android state-machine threaded-code

Last synced: 18 Dec 2024

https://github.com/mk590901/multi_bloc

Repository contains project implementing account management via flutter BLoC by means flat state machines.

dart flutter multiblocprovider state-machine

Last synced: 18 Dec 2024

https://github.com/mk590901/temperature_sensor_simulator

The project is a flutter app that simulates temperature measurement.

architecture architecture-components bloc dart flutter metro-style multiblocprovider state-machine

Last synced: 18 Dec 2024

https://github.com/mk590901/event-driven-bloc-s-switch-widgets

The repository contains a collection of four types of event driven BLoC's switch widgets and demo sample app.

bloc dart event-driven flutter state-machine switch widget

Last synced: 18 Dec 2024

https://github.com/mk590901/multitouch_bloc

Repository contains project implementing drawing on canvas via flutter BLoC pattern by means flat state machines.

bloc dart flutter multiblocprovider state-machine

Last synced: 18 Dec 2024

https://github.com/mk590901/flutter_metro_stateless_multitouch

Repository contains project implementing refresh the metro- style widget via flutter BLoC pattern by means flat state machine class.

bloc dart flutter metro-style state-machine

Last synced: 18 Dec 2024

https://github.com/e1izabeth/expressionsparser

Simple PEG parser and interpreter of math or regular expressions (or whatever you describe)

peg-parser regular-expression-engine state-machine

Last synced: 19 Dec 2024